Default Satellite : Gain One, Lose One for SES

On Wednesday, SES Astra, the European satellite unit for SES, said its new Astra 1M satellite was successfully deployed at its final orbital position at 19.2 degrees East and is ready for commercial operations.

The satellite, which launched from Kazakhstan in November, will deliver direct-to-home and HDTV services throughout continental Europe. SES said the platform will offer important replacement capacity and support its HDTV platform serving the continent.

While that was good news for the satellite services provider, SES recently reported that its Astra 5A satellite, operating at 31.5 degrees East, experienced a technical anomaly leading to the end of the spacecraft's mission.

SES Astra said it has informed impacted customers and switched a substantial part of the affected traffic to another Astra satellite at 23.5 degrees East. German cable operators getting service from the satellite were among the transferred customers, the company said.

The satellite, originally known as Sirius 2, was launched in November 1997.
